6
Commissioning
Before commissioning it must be checked that:
The device has been installed and connected in accordance with the guidelines provided
in chapter 4 "Installing / Mounting (Page 15)" and 5 "Connecting (Page 19)"

6.1 Zero point adjustment
Commissioning the device includes performing a zero point adjustment. In the following it is
described how to prepare for a zero point adjustment, and how to activate an auto zero point
adjustment.
Before zero point adjusting
Make sure the shut-off valves before and after the sensor are fully opened.
Figure 6-1 Installation with shut-off valves
Auto zero point adjustment
1. Power up and acclimate the transmitter (min. 30 min).
2. Pump gas at max. flow through the sensor (min. 2 min).
